Property, Up-grading and Utilization of Bio-oil from Biomass
Zhu Xifeng,Zheng Jilu,Guo Qingxiang,Zhu Qingshi
Strategic Study of CAE 2005, Volume 7, Issue 9, Pages 83-88
Element content, chemical composition, stability, viscosity and heat value of bio-oil are analyzedSome new technologies to refine and to utilize bio-oil are introduced such as directly catalyzing bio-oilvapor, and adding surfactants into bio-oil,so that it can be used directly in diesel engine.The catalysts and their effects on the refining and utilization of bio-oil are discussed.

Development of Biomass Pyrolysis Set and Its Experimental Research
Zhu Xifeng,Zheng Jilu,Lu Qiang,Guo Qingxiang,Zhu Qingshi
Strategic Study of CAE 2006, Volume 8, Issue 10, Pages 89-93
This paper introduces a kind of biomass pyrolysis set based on fluidized-bed, which has such characteristics.Experimental result shows that the developed pyrolysis set is available to convert biomass into bio-oiland all biomass have an optimal temperature for maximum bio-oil yields.The analysis indicates that the calorific value of bio-oil is about 17 MJ/kg and bio-oil is a mixtureThe research also shows that drying biomass can effectively reduce the moisture in bio-oil, and the bio-oil
